China’s consumer internet is served mainly by China Telecom, China Unicom, and China Mobile. Popular local targets include Taobao, Tmall, JD.com, and Baidu. China's Great Firewall blocks most Western sites and heavily filters traffic, so mainland IPs behave very differently and local platforms like Taobao are the main targets.
